Cosmic Force joins Newgate roster in 2020

Deep Field.
Deep Field. Picture: Newgate Farm

Deep Field (Northern Meteor) will stand for an increased fee of $55,000 (inc GST) at Newgate Farm in 2020 and he will be joined on the roster by his Group 2-winning son Cosmic Force, who is set to stand his first season for an introductory fee of $16,500 (inc GST). 

Cosmic Force won the Pago Pago Stakes (Gr 3, 1200m) as a two-year-old and the Roman Consul Stakes (Gr 2, 1200m) at three and he retired with $486,765 in career prize-money. 

The colt is out of winning Commands (Danehill) mare Little Zeta, making him a half-brother to Group 3 winner Onemorezeta (Onemorenomore), while further afield he was from the family of Listed winner More Than Great (More Than Ready). 

Deep Field - who stood for a fee of $44,000 (inc GST) in 2019 - has sired three stakes winners this season, including Cosmic Force, while the stallion has also enjoyed good success in the sales ring, with 56 of his yearlings selling for an aggregate of $8,546,933 at an average of $152,623. 

The son of Northern Meteor’s (Encosta De Lago) exploits as a sire were no more prevalent than this weekend when his daughter Xilong posted an impressive performance to win the Euclase Stakes (Gr 2, 1200m) at Morphettville. 

Deep Field and Cosmic Force will stand alongside newcomers Tassort (Brazen Beau) and Brutal (O’Reilly), who will stand their first seasons for $11,000 (inc GST) and $27,500 (inc GST) respectively. 

Russian Revolution (Snitzel), whose first foals are on the ground, will stand for reduced fee of $44,000 (inc GST), having stood last season for $55,000 (inc GST), while Menari - another son of Snitzel (Redoute’s Choice) - will stand for $16,500 (inc GST) in 2020.

Golden Slipper Stakes (Gr 1, 1200m) winner Capitalist (Written Tycoon) - whose first crop were well received in the sales ring, with 97 yearlings selling for an aggregate of $16,147,000 at an average of $166,463 and he will stand for $44,000 (inc GST), having stood last season for $55,000 (inc GST). He will have his first runners next season. 

Meanwhile, Extreme Choice (Not A Single Doubt), whose progeny also hit the track next season, will stand at a fee of $22,000 (inc GST), while Flying Artie and Winning Rupert - who will also have their first runners next season - will both stand at $16,500 (inc GST). 

The Newgate roster is completed by Dissident (Sebring), Wandjina (Snitzel), and Super One (I Am Invincible) will all stand for $11,000 (inc GST) in 2020.
